The Aspen Acres Fire in Colorado continues to spread, destroying 55 homes in one county and over 100 structures in another. Strong winds and dry conditions are hampering firefighting efforts, with thousands of residents evacuated.

According to CBS News, the wildfire has caused damage across multiple Colorado counties. Fire officials say strong winds and low humidity are the main drivers of rapid fire spread. Thousands of residents have received evacuation orders, with additional communities under evacuation warnings.

This is one of the most severe wildfire events in Colorado this year. The governor has declared a state of emergency and requested FEMA assistance.
